With ArchiCAD I can create a file .pla (archived plan) whith inside the texture and the object than I have used in my project.
I can do the same thing with Artlantis R: save as archive...

I think it was a greath thing if maxwell have similar option: a routine than collect and organize in subdirectory all the external linked files.
